# Heads up, plugin folks: we carved the user module out of the old Bramblecart monolith
# into its own service called Userloom. Your plugins now talk to it over the bridge API
# instead of poking the shared database. Timeouts default to 5s.
# The bridge auth credential gets set on the line right below this one.

vault entry, kagep-yajeg: COURIER_KEY5=da097

Internal Memo — Budget Request

To the sales leads: Operations has submitted a budget request to fund two additional demo kits for the Vellane product line and travel support for the Ashgrove territory push. Finance expects a decision within two weeks. No changes to current spending limits until then; log any urgent needs with your regional coordinator. Background on the request's purpose appears below.

board note of fahaf-fadug: Gilixax Logistics is in early talks to buy Praiusax Partners for about $8.1 million. The Pramir launch date is September 23, and nothing goes to the press before then.

**Night-shift access — support team.** Before a new starter's first overnight rotation at Pellbrook House, confirm they appear on the night roster held by the duty manager and that their induction record is marked complete in Graften. Walk them through the fire-muster point on Ryle Street and show them the out-of-hours sign-in tablet at the side entrance, since reception closes at 19:00. Their permanent badge won't work after hours until provisioned, so for the first week they should use the code below.

staff pass of kawip-hawef = bdg-QLP-2